Security Forces Intensify Operations in Manipur, Seize Improvised Canons

Northeast Desk, 1st July: Security forces in Manipur have ramped up search operations and area domination exercises in the fringe and vulnerable areas of the state’s hill and valley districts, resulting in significant recoveries and strict enforcement measures.

During these operations, three improvised canons, locally known as Pumpi, were seized in Churachandpur District, underscoring the ongoing security concerns in the region.

In addition to these recoveries, security forces facilitated the safe movement of essential items, ensuring the transport of 357 vehicles along NH-2. Enhanced security measures, including convoys in sensitive areas, were implemented to guarantee the free and safe passage of these vehicles.

To further strengthen security, a total of 129 Nakas and checkpoints have been installed across various districts in both hill and valley regions. These measures have led to the detention of 68 individuals for various violations, highlighting the effectiveness of the intensified security efforts.
